Subject: Pricing experiment cut-over complete

The Farrowgate ticket-pricing experiment is now fully cut over to the new allocation engine. Legacy price hooks are disabled; plugins must use the v2 surface. No action needed unless your plugin reads bucket names directly. Effective configuration for the new engine follows below.

settings of tagef-bawif:
DRUIX_HOST=druix.zemvarlabs.internal
DRUIX_PORT=8000

### Step 4: Wire up trace propagation

Okay, this is the part plugin authors actually need to get right. Starting with Loomtrace v5, your plugin must forward the incoming trace headers on every outbound call — the Pellinor gateway drops untagged requests now, no exceptions. Grab the context object from the hook arguments rather than constructing your own. Before testing, make sure your local settings match the reference configuration shown below.

config for kawif-hahig:
zorix:
  log_level: error
  metrics_host: metrics.zorix.lumiclabs.internal
  pool_size: 16

## Ticket: SQL lint failing in staging

Squeegee's SQL linter skips every file in staging. Cause: LINT_RULESET pointed at the retired `v1-rules` bundle. Fix: set LINT_RULESET=standard-v3 and restart the lint runner. Runner also pulls rule updates from the Quarrel registry, which needs auth; its token goes on the next line.

sealed setting: LEDGER_TOKEN13=5d842615a26d7

Action item from the Lintbox UI outage: pin all consumers of the Fernwood component library to exact versions. New team members should know that a minor bump in Fernwood broke the checkout flow because ranges were left open. The build now rejects caret ranges automatically. The enforcement thresholds are listed below.

tuning constants:
QUOTAS = {
    "ralael": 1,
    "druath": 1,
    "oliwyn": 2,
    "holath": 10,
}

RUNBOOK: Soft deletes, orders table (Cartvale service). Orders are never hard-deleted; a tombstone flag plus timestamp marks removal, and the reaper job purges rows past retention. Do not run manual DELETEs — restores depend on tombstones. If the reaper stalls, check its lease lock first, then requeue. Retention windows differ per region, so verify before purging anything. The reaper's active configuration is reproduced below.

config for bagep-kageg:
ULADOR_LOG_LEVEL=warn
ULADOR_METRICS_HOST=metrics.ulador.tolvaqcorp.corp
ULADOR_POOL_SIZE=32